    Thank goodness this place was merely busy when we stepped in and not jammed packed. As it was, it was intimidating enough. As soon as you walk in the door, the counter is to your right. That's where you order your food, pay for your food AND your groceries. The menu is above the counter. Stand to one side and figure out what you want. Then walk straight further into the store and watch to your left and you'll see the end of the line. It curls around a couple of displays and then you'll be facing the counter. Don't step into the walk-way until a cashier is available or you'll clog up the works. Place your order, don't dawdle. Pay and now step aside until they call your name or a reasonable version of it. (You don't have to give your real name. I recommend something simple and easy to pronounce. The staff works quickly and is very efficient. Some are friendlier than others, but when my cashier made fun of my poor Spanish accent, I told her that my revenge would come when she tried to order in a Chinese Restaurant. She laughed at that. We ordered three items for the two of us. Much too much food but we wanted to try different flavors and textures. It's not like we hadn't had these flavors before elsewhere but we had never had them here. Carne Asada Street Taco - 5 - Whole lotta stuff on two corn tortillas. A ton of flavor. Two of these would have made enough of a meal. Super Quesadilla with Al Pastor - 5 - All folded up and stuffed into a clam shell, it came with sour cream and guacamole. Yummilicious! Cabeza Super Burrito - 5 - The meat from the cheeks of a cow. Loaded with all the trimmings that you would expect from a Super Burrito, the meat was super juicy and tender. Unfortunately, like most burritos, it would have made for a boring picture. It was large enough that next time, I'll ask to have it cut in half and wrapped separately. Definitely a place worth returning to!
